Transaction 5bb7931fdc19e815c608736b4b0b9a5c15a4e11f3277c138972a7b58a823b75d

23 Input
2 Outputs
  • 5bb7931fdc19e815c608736b4b0b9a5c15a4e11f3277c138972a7b58a823b75d:0
  • value  1884489
    address  1KZDLzs9W9KLCixXZjixAFZLrxeNHqC21X
  • 5bb7931fdc19e815c608736b4b0b9a5c15a4e11f3277c138972a7b58a823b75d:1
  • value  500000000
    address  3DcPMYLBV8ux9X63RRgvKp8DkjdBy3admZ